[Laszlo-dev] For Review: Change 20080517-ptw-l Summary: Docbook style tweaks

Donald Anderson dda at ddanderson.com
Mon May 19 11:55:15 PDT 2008


LPP-5537 was originally opened because the docs for <a> didn't look
the same.  To fudge it short term, I moved some content that used to
appear in the attribute description to the main content, and that has
to be moved back.

On May 19, 2008, at 2:23 PM, P T Withington wrote:

> Is there more needed than what I filed as:
>
> LPP-6011 'Reference CSS fonts need rationalization'
>
> ?  If not, I will close 5537 with a note that the font differences  
> are global, not just in the <a> entry.
>
> On 2008-05-19, at 13:31 EDT, Donald Anderson wrote:
>
>> Approved!
>>
>> We'll need a separate commit to fully close LPP-5537 (get <a> pages  
>> to look the same).
>>
>> On May 17, 2008, at 3:22 PM, P T Withington wrote:
>>
>>> [I will check this in so people can build the docs to review]
>>>
>>> Change 20080517-ptw-l by ptw at dueling-banjos.local on 2008-05-17  
>>> 15:09:48 EDT
>>>  in /Users/ptw/OpenLaszlo/ringding-clean
>>>  for http://svn.openlaszlo.org/openlaszlo/trunk
>>>
>>> Summary: Docbook style tweaks
>>>
>>> New Features:
>>>
>>> Bugs Fixed:
>>> LPP-5949 'Attribute formatting issues on reference pages:  
>>> highlight and hrules'
>>> LPP-5537 '<a> reference page: need lists and other markup within  
>>> attribute description'
>>>
>>> Technical Reviewer: dda (pending)
>>> QA Reviewer: amuntz (pending)
>>> Doc Reviewer: liorio (pending)
>>>
>>> Details:
>>>  js2doc2dbk.xsl: Tweak layout of tables to use uniform columns and  
>>> to
>>>  give class to entries so we can style them correctly with CSS.
>>>  Also process attribute, parameter, return, and event descriptions
>>>  so that they can contain markup.
>>>
>>>  parameters.xsl: Turn on table extensions, repair table.borders
>>>  settings to work, but leave them off.
>>>
>>>  lzx-print-pretty.css:  Remove redundant style
>>>
>>>  docbook.css:  Consolodate redundant styles.  Add bottom border to
>>>  attribute descriptions.  Make some font specs proportional so they
>>>  work better in different contexts.
>>>
>>>  styles.css:  Fix a syntax error noticed in passing.  Remove
>>>  redundant styles.  Make some font specs proporional.
>>>
>>> Tests:
>>>  Visual inspection
>>>
>>> Files:
>>> M      docs/src/xsl/js2doc2dbk.xsl
>>> M      docs/src/xsl/parameters.xsl
>>> M      docs/includes/lzx-pretty-print.css
>>> M      docs/includes/docbook.css
>>> M      docs/includes/styles.css
>>>
>>> Changeset: http://svn.openlaszlo.org/openlaszlo/patches/20080517-ptw-l.tar
>>
>>
>> --
>>
>> Don Anderson
>> Java/C/C++, Berkeley DB, systems consultant
>>
>> voice: 617-547-7881
>> email: dda at ddanderson.com
>> www: http://www.ddanderson.com
>>
>>
>>
>>
>


--

Don Anderson
Java/C/C++, Berkeley DB, systems consultant

voice: 617-547-7881
email: dda at ddanderson.com
www: http://www.ddanderson.com






More information about the Laszlo-dev mailing list